Considered as a whole, there is insufficient research to state with confidence that uncorrected vision slows progression of myopia, and there is no evidence to indicate that under-correction slows progression of myopia. In fact, the research instead demonstrates that under-correction either makes no difference to …

Children wearing multifocal lenses had 25% less myopia progression and 31% less axial elongation than … WebbThe first signs of myopia generally appear at around the age of 6 and progression can reach up to two dioptres per year. Progression usually stops when the child stops growing. In Asia, it is not unusual to see children with myopia of -8 dioptres or more. Progressive myopia is due to abnormal lengthening of the eye.

Webb25 okt. 2024 · 1. Follow the “20-20-20 rule” when reading or looking at a screen. After 20 minutes of reading or looking at a screen, take a 20 second break and focus your eyes on something that’s at least 20 feet (6.1 m) away. These quick, easy breaks can help reduce eye strain and may slow the onset or progression of myopia. [9]
